Creating Consistent Instagram Aesthetics with Editing Apps
To create a consistent aesthetic for your Instagram profile, using the right editing apps is crucial. These apps allow users to apply similar filters and settings to their photos, ensuring that the overall look of their feed remains cohesive. When choosing an editing app, look for features that enable batch processing. Doing so can save time by applying the same adjustments to multiple images at once, enhancing consistency. Popular apps such as Adobe Lightroom and VSCO are known for their robust editing tools and user-friendly interfaces. They provide extensive presets and customizable filters that consider different lighting conditions and themes. Additionally, using color palettes that align with your brand is essential. By doing this, you can create a visual narrative that resonates with your audience. Experiment with the various settings and filters available in these apps to find your unique style while maintaining consistency. A well-edited photo can elevate your posts and maximize engagement by attracting more followers to your profile. Remember to stay true to your brand’s identity throughout the editing process. Consistency is a key element in creating a recognizable Instagram aesthetic that engages your community.
Another effective way to maintain a consistent Instagram aesthetic is by leveraging presets. Presets are predefined settings that can be applied with a single click, drastically improving editing efficiency. You can purchase or create your own presets tailored to your unique style. With apps such as Lightroom, importing presets is simple. Once you establish presets matching your aesthetic, you can quickly edit new photos, allowing you to focus on content creation rather than lengthy edits. Furthermore, using the same crop ratios and aspect ratios across your images contributes to uniformity. This specificity makes your profile look aesthetically pleasing. Using presets also enhances brand recognition among your audience and creates a professional look to your images. Ensure that you test every preset on different photo types to gauge its versatility. Effective presets usually adapt well to various lighting conditions and subject matters. Maintaining this level of consistency helps solidify your unique style. Additionally, you can share your presets with your fans to create a sense of community. Engage with your audience by showcasing how they can use your presets in their photography.
Balancing Filters and Authenticity
While editing apps provide the ability to create beautiful images, it’s essential to strike a balance between enhancement and authenticity. Over-editing can lead to unrealistic portrayals of people or places. Filtered photos that stray too far from reality can cause followers to feel disconnected. Experiment with filters that enhance but do not distort the intrinsic quality of your images. Incorporate natural-looking adjustments that align with your aesthetic while still keeping elements recognizable. Your goal should be to create a visually appealing gallery while remaining authentic. It helps to have a clear understanding of the emotions and messages each photo communicates. Experiment with both light and color adjustments to subtly enhance rather than transform your images. Authentic content resonates better with audiences because it fosters trust and loyalty. By being genuine in your editing choices, you create a transparent connection with your followers. Consistency should prioritize colors and themes while embracing a natural approach to editing for lasting impact. Remember, you can enhance your aesthetic without compromising authenticity in your visual storytelling.
Utilizing stock photos and graphics can also boost your brand aesthetic on Instagram. Stock photos can seamlessly blend with your original content. They can enhance the overall visual experience while adding variety to your posting schedule. Various websites offer high-quality images that fit specific themes or concepts. When choosing stock photos, ensure they align with the color palette and theme of your feed. Use editing apps for final touches that harmonize with your imagery, further ensuring a consistent look. Moreover, incorporating graphics or text overlays can help in communicating messages directly while retaining the visual style of your brand. Apps like Canva allow users to overlay graphics creatively without significant graphic design skills. Ensure that your graphics complement rather than distract from the main imagery. Choose designs that resonate with the emotions you hope to convey. Additionally, maintaining a cohesive font style across graphics can enhance your brand identity. Consistently incorporating stock images or graphics adds depth and interest to your feed while strengthening your aesthetic narrative over time.
Photo Composition and Editing Techniques
In addition to editing apps, understanding photo composition is vital for creating visually striking Instagram images. Strong composition lays the foundation for effective storytelling and appeals to viewers. Techniques such as the rule of thirds can significantly improve photo outcomes. Remember to consider lighting as you compose your shots to achieve a balanced look. Post-editing adjustments can further enhance these composition techniques through tools available in apps. Cropping, aligning, and adjusting the focus area can redirect viewers’ attention to the most significant elements of the photo. Use these editing apps to refine the composition after shooting; this can drastically impact viewer engagement and overall aesthetic. Experiment with different angles and perspectives during photography to keep your feed dynamic. An engaging Instagram feed should balance diverse compositions while maintaining its core style. Continually evolving your techniques will assist in developing a unique visual voice. By merging composition strategies with effective editing, you create images that not only look appealing but tell a story that draws in viewers.
Another vital element in achieving a cohesive Instagram aesthetic is honing your editing workflow. Developing a seamless process speeds up photo editing and makes maintaining consistency easier. Start by selecting your favorite editing tools and establishing a cropping ratio. Develop a habit of checking your camera settings before taking pictures, ensuring each shot meets quality standards. After that, categorize your photos by themes or colors to streamline the editing process. Create an organized system that allows you to identify and edit photos efficiently, saving time while ensuring a consistent look. Use batch editing features when available; this significantly reduces time dr spent on repetitive adjustments. Embrace the use of mobile editing apps for on-the-go convenience. Apps like Snapseed or Afterlight offer various tools for mobile editing without sacrificing quality. Maintain a checklist of essential adjustments, ensuring you apply similar settings across your photos. The combination of efficiency and consistency enhances your Instagram aesthetic and your overall content strategy, allowing you to maintain a high-quality feed that captures your audience’s attention.
